SMBJ5925CE3/TR13
Product Overview
- Category: Electronic Component
- Use: Voltage Suppression in Electronic Circuits
- Characteristics: Transient Voltage Suppressor Diode
- Package: SMB
- Essence: Protects electronic circuits from voltage spikes
- Packaging/Quantity: Tape & Reel, 3000 units per reel
Specifications
- Voltage - Reverse Standoff (Typ): 58.9V
- Voltage - Breakdown (Min): 65.5V
- Voltage - Clamping (Max) @ Ipp: 94.3V
- Current - Peak Pulse (10/1000µs): 19.2A
- Power - Peak Pulse: 600W
- Type: Zener

Working Principles
The SMBJ5925CE3/TR13 operates by diverting excess voltage away from the protected circuit when a transient voltage spike occurs. It does this by rapidly switching into a low-impedance state, effectively clamping the voltage to a safe level.
